Search Jobs

DevOps- Assoc. Delivery Manager

Required Skills:  DevOps
Location:  Bangalore, Trivandrum
Category: 
Experience:  10-13 yrs.
Last Date:  22-01-2017
Job Description: 

Primary Technology Jenkins Please specify if others Extensive experience in DevOps life cycle and tools Responsibilities: Technical � You will be charged with architecting, designing, developing, and supporting the most visible Internet-scale infrastructure. o Principal responsibility for release and deployment strategy and execution. o Manage release and deployment cycles for highly available, scalable production infrastructure. o Work with engineering leadership to drive no downtime release strategy. o Ensure development of the operational procedures and monitoring platform and services. o Drive monitoring & alert tooling to detect, triage and resolve issues quickly. o Influence and create standards and methods for deployment of large-scale distributed systems. o Establish practices to respond to issues when they occur and build automation to prevent problem recurrence. � Experience in working in public and/or private cloud infrastructure � desirable OR virtualized environment o Managing the infrastructure powering at a massive scale requires you to master (eg: AWS) cloud architectures, designing effective high availability network topologies, as well as, having a mastery of hardware and software load balancers. You will apply deep understanding of clustering techniques to SQL and NoSQL storage and design and implement effective disaster recovery strategies. � Apply deep knowledge of monitoring tools, and NOC operations to manage 24/7 NOC team. o Ownership of the availability and scalability of all systems within scope irrespective of who created/modified it. Account � Accountable for developing and executing strategy to meet and exceed planned revenue and gross margin targets � Collaborate with Sales and marketing team to develop and execute plans for revenue generation � Understand in depth the customer's business and priorities � Ensure delivery of contractual commitments adherence to the project management office�s delivery and risk mitigation standards; drive compliance with operational aspects of the IT service practice � Work with the Onsite counterpart(Program Manager) in ensuring delivery success � First level of escalation point for Client for any delivery and contractual commitments � Identify and deliver value added services to help meet customer goals and manage customer expectations � Maintain high level of communication and connect with the customer at all levels of management including the Senior Leadership team (CXO level) � Supervise and mentor associate program managers and/or project managers who run multi-resource projects from inception to conclusion while maintaining high customer satisfaction � Plan capacity and develop talent and leadership pipeline to support to grow the account and organization � Manage revenue growth, EBITDA growth and margin for the account � Responsible for the ultimate success and satisfaction of internal and external customers and partners by communicating and working collaboratively with project teams, customers, legal and sales functions and subject matter experts to achieve customer and UST objectives � Proactively identify and resolve issues that impact customer satisfaction. Organization success or employee engagement Competencies: Technical � IT services industry experience of 12 years or more with at least o 10 years hands on experience with operations of mission critical software infrastructure. o 4 years with project leadership of DevOps engagements including 2 years of client facing role o 2 years of program management experience including o 5+ years hands on experience with managing cloud infrastructure, with preference for AWS. � Experience managing and collaborating large, geographically distributed and multi-faceted DevOps teams including definition of processes, metrics, tools selection and automation � Experience maintaining highly available, scalable systems. � Deliver key DevOps and NOC initiatives including planning and team organization and execution. � Expert in Ops Management tools and have a deep understanding of change control protocols and procedures. � Ensure standardized, mature change management and release management processes and automate deployment and maintenance procedures using industry-standard scripting languages. � Expertise with deployment tools like Puppet, Chef. � Proficient in building, deploying, troubleshooting and maintaining web and application servers. � Proven success building and maintaining backup and/or disaster recovery infrastructure. � Experience deploying and managing production monitoring systems. � Proficient in one or more of - Shell, Ruby, Python. � Implement automated infrastructure testing. � Systematic problem solving approach, coupled with a strong sense of ownership and drive. � Configure and tune an enterprise monitoring and instrumentation system(s) to efficiently detect existing issues and predict future issues based on trends. � Orchestrate the provisioning, load balancing, dynamic configuration/re-configuration, monitoring and spend optimization of servers across cloud providers, data centers, availability zones. � Performance analysis and capacity planning � maintaining performance models on all applications and systems. � Improve the performance, security, redundancy and availability of systems. � Maintaining database security and controlling permissions. � Monitoring database performance. � Configuration Management building blocks using tools such as Chef or Puppet. � Rapid response, trouble-shoot, and triage of production issues. � Develop a comprehensive infrastructure policy. � Apply information security best practices and respond to security events. � Be very comfortable in the command line, writing scripts, etc. � Analyze processes, recommend improvements, and write process documentation. � Experience in Enterprise/Scaled agile development. Account � IT services industry experience of 12 years or more with at least o 1 year with Sales, Business Development (BD). � Evidence superior Software Engineering skills � Proven ability to target and reach high standards � Stellar verbal/written communication, organization and interpersonal skills and demonstrated effectiveness in a customer facing role � Should have demonstrated people management skills having managed, mentored and developed a team of 50 members or more. � Good customer testimonials as a project/program manager � Industry accredited Project management certification is good to have. CSM or other Agile practice certifications desirable. � Should have cross cultural experience � Effectively Partner and collaborate with different functions � Should have managed a project/program of 2.5 million or more for a year � Should have managed an incremental growth of 500K or more in a year � Growing, technology-driven company experience a plus.

 

Login to Apply